Crucible, Amazon's free-to-play PvPvE shooter releases May 20

Crucible launches in a little over two weeks.

Crucible, Amazon Games' free-to-play team-based shooter, finally has a release date. The game will be available on May 20 on Steam.

Crucible is a PvPvE shooter where you get to pick from ten characters - called hunters - that each bring unique weapons and abilities to the fight. Players are dropped into an open world to fight monsters and each other, and to survive the planet's dangers. As you play, you collect Essence, which you can invest back into your character to boost your power.

Crucible launches with three modes: Heart of the Hives, Harvester Command, and Alpha Hunters. In Heart of the Hives (4v4), each team races to fight bosses while fending off the other team, with the ultimate goal of capturing three Hive hearts. Harvester Command (8v8) takes the PvP a bit further with two teams both trying to capture and hold as many Harvesters as possible to reach the Essence target.
